Job Overview:

Due to our continued global growth, we are seeking a motivated and detail-oriented Trade Compliance Coordinator. This role is crucial in supporting Key Account Trade Compliance Functions with KPI and product reporting, ensuring smooth movement of items across borders and compliance with local and international regulations.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Work closely with line reports and operators to ensure smooth movement of items across borders.
  • Determine correct tariff classifications for all supported brands within the Key Account function, especially for items moving from the EU.
  • Issue country-specific guidance (for the UK) on additional import requirements for stock products, predominantly from the EU.
  • Maintain close liaison with line reporting and provide support to the Head of Function.
  • Provide support on internal projects requiring input, involvement, or expertise from Trade Compliance.
  • Audit and monitor entries to ensure compliance with local import and export legislation and support brand KPI audit requirements.
  • Ensure all operational activities are completed and followed up correctly in accordance with SOPs and organisational policy.
  • Facilitate imports and exports of non-stock goods, completing and supplying documents and declarations.
  • Liaise with HMRC and assist with maintenance on customs procedures.
  • Maintain the CITES portal, uploading import and re-export CITES certificates.
  • Implement and improve client workflow efficiencies in conjunction with the line manager.
  • Report any new sales leads to the line manager for distribution to the sales team.
  • Create and maintain written procedures.
  • Ensure all reports and KPIs are generated by given deadlines and handed to the line manager for submission to each area of Key Accounts.
  • Complete ad-hoc and spot checks on entries and submit reports to the line manager and Head of Department weekly.

Skills, Experience, and Competencies:

  • Experience within customs/trade compliance in a large business or brokerage firm with an in-depth understanding of UK and EU Customs regulations.
  • Proficient understanding of international trade, import duties, commodity codes, incoterms, preference, and valuation.
  • Fluent in English (verbal and written) with expert communication skills across all levels.
  • Intermediate Excel skills.
  • Ability to work as part of a team as well as independently.
  • Demonstrate initiative and drive to meet deadlines while working in a busy environment.
